At Vantor, we transform data from space into mission advantage. Working alongside the U.S. Space Force and mission partners, you’ll help develop and rapidly deploy the next generation of resilient space-sensing capabilities that deliver critical information to warfighters and strengthen national security.
As a Cybersecurity Engineer, you’ll play a vital role in ensuring these systems are secure, resilient, and ready for the mission. You’ll test, analyze, evaluate, verify, and validate system performance while identifying vulnerabilities and areas requiring urgent mitigation early in the development lifecycle. Using advanced technologies and innovative engineering methodologies, you’ll help solve complex cybersecurity challenges and build solutions designed to withstand evolving threats.
You’ll work across disciplines, partnering with engineers, operators, and mission stakeholders to integrate cybersecurity throughout the system life cycle. Your ability to think critically, collaborate effectively, and translate emerging threats into practical solutions will help protect the space-sensing capabilities our warfighters depend on.

Qualifications
-
7+ years of experience as a cybersecurity engineer supporting Major Defense Acquisition Programs, including space, ground, and hardware systems
-
Experience providing input to Risk Management Framework process activities and documentation
-
Experience planning and executing Mission Based Cyber Risk Assessments (MBCRA) and Mission Based Risk Assessments – Cyber (MBRA-C)
-
Experience developing threat scenarios that can be used to support cyber test events such as Cyber Table Top (CTT)
-
Knowledge of cybersecurity, privacy principles, computer networking concepts and protocols, and network security methodologies
-
Knowledge of network design processes, including security objectives, operational objectives, and trade-offs
-
Ability to perform technical analyses of cybersecurity architectures and network diagrams
-
Secret clearance
-
Bachelor’s degree
-
DoD 8140 Level II Certification such as Security+ Certification
Preferred Qualifications
-
Experience with space-based remote sensing systems
-
Experience developing system security context and a preliminary system security Concept of Operations (CONOPS), and defining baseline system security requirements in accordance with applicable cybersecurity requirements
-
TS/SCI clearance
-
Bachelor’s degree in Engineering, IT, Information Assurance, Information Security, or a related field preferred; Master’s degree in Engineering, IT, Information Assurance, or Information Security a plus
-
DoD 8140 Level III Certification such as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P), ISSEP, or ISSAP Certification
